URGENT - WEATHER MESSAGE National Weather Service Blacksburg VA 906 PM EDT Sun Mar 15 2026 ...WIND ADVISORY REMAINS IN EFFECT FROM 11 AM MONDAY TO 2 AM EDT TUESDAY... * WHAT...West winds 15 to 25 mph with gusts up to 45 mph expected. * WHERE...Portions of north central and northwest North Carolina, central, south central, southwest, and west central Virginia, and southeast West Virginia. * WHEN...From 11 AM Monday to 2 AM EDT Tuesday. * IMPACTS...Gusty winds will blow around unsecured objects. Tree limbs could be blown down and a few power outages may result.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Winds this strong can make driving difficult, especially for high profile vehicles. Use extra caution. Secure outdoor objects.
